Faculty and Staff Training
The Faculty and Staff Training program is designed to support the campus's goal of creating more meaningful connections between faculty, staff, and students. This program provides training resources for faculty and staff interested in mentoring the campus community.
Program Overview
The Faculty and Staff Mentors Program offers training to interested faculty and staff to understand their role in increasing mentoring across campus. The program focuses on one-on-one, group, and episodic mentoring opportunities tailored to the individual's needs, time, and commitment.
Mentoring Opportunities
- The program provides training for faculty and staff to engage in one-on-one mentoring
- This type of mentoring allows for personalized support and guidance
- Group mentoring opportunities are also available
- These sessions enable faculty and staff to mentor multiple students at once
- Episodic mentoring is another option
- This type of mentoring involves short-term, focused support and guidance
Program Goals
The Faculty and Staff Mentors Program aims to increase mentoring across campus by providing faculty and staff with the necessary training and support to establish formalized mentoring connections and relationships with students.
